Fontspec is a package for XeLaTeX and LuaLaTeX. It provides an automatic and unified interface to feature-rich AAT and OpenType fonts through the NFSS in LaTeX running on XeTeX or LuaTeX engines.

Fonetika Dania is a font bundle with a serif font and a sans serif font for the Danish phonetic system Dania. Both fonts exist in regular and bold weights. LaTeX support is provided.

This is Fontname, a naming scheme for (the base part of) external TeX font filenames. This makes at most eight-character names from (almost) arbitrarily complex font names, thus helping portability of TeX documents.
Open Sans is a humanist sans serif typeface designed by Steve Matteson. The package provides support for this font family in LaTeX. It includes the original TrueType fonts, as well as Type 1 versions.
This package provides some macros for right-to-left typesetting. It uses by default the Arabic fonts Scheherazade and ALM fixed, the only monospaced Arabic font. The package only works with LuaLaTeX or XeLaTeX.
The endfloat
package places all floats on pages by themselves at the end of the document, optionally leaving markers in the text near to where the figure (or table) would normally have occurred.
The mdframed
package develops the facilities of framed
in providing breakable framed and coloured boxes. The user may instruct the package to perform its operations using default LaTeX commands, PStricks or TikZ.
This package provides a mechanism to include fragments of DVI files with the graphicx
package, so that you can use \includegraphics
to include DVI files. The package requires the dvipaste
program.

This package provides a document class and bibliographic style that prepares documents in the style required by the ASCE. These are unofficial files, not sanctioned by that organization.
This package provides a set of fonts that extend the txfonts
bundle with small caps and old style numbers, together with Greek support. The extensions are made with modifications of the GNU Freefont.
This package records the value that was last set, for any counter of interest. Since most such counters are simply incremented when they are changed, the recorded value will usually be the maximum value.
The package implements a decorative swelled rule using only a symbol from a font installed with all distributions of TeX, so it works independently, without the need to install any additional software or fonts.
The package uses PSTricks to provide basic three-dimensional objects. As yet, only cubes (which can be deformed to rectangular parallelipipeds) and dies (which are only a special kind of cubes) are defined.

The package calculates and prints rows of Pascal's triangle. It may be used to print successive rows of the triangle, or to print the rows inside an array
or tabular
environment.
The package counts the actual pages in the document (as opposed to reporting the number of the last page, as does lastpage
). The counter itself may be shipped out to the DVI file.
The package provides means for retrieving properties of chemical elements like atomic number, element symbol, element name, electron distribution or isotope number. Properties are defined for the elements up to the atomic number 112.

The package provides support for rendering UML diagrams using the syntax and tools of PlantUML. The PlantUML syntax is very short and thus enables quickly specifying UML diagrams. Using dot
, PlantUML layouts the diagrams.
This package allows you to input Thai characters directly to LaTeX documents and choose any (system wide) Thai fonts for typesetting in XeLaTeX. It also tries to appropriately justify paragraphs with no more external tools.
